1. Mobile web analytics – Countly

Analytics is crucial for the smooth and intelligent operation of any digital asset, your mobile website included. One of the most popular analytics tools for mobile websites is “Countly.” The Countly platform offers a host of mobile analytics options for those who are interested in analyzing the performance of their website. The platform offers push notifications, crash reports, attribution tracking, user profile management, and segmentation services. Using Countly, will give better understanding regarding the effectiveness of elements on your mobile website including mobile ads.

2. Testing platform – Perfecto Mobile

Testing is the underlying process running in the background, helping you identify problems in your site, hopefully catching them before they harm performance or user satisfaction from your mobile web experience. Perfecto Mobile is a global provider of cloud-based testing, automation and monitoring solutions for mobile applications and websites. Perfecto Mobile solution addresses the need for companies to continuously test and monitor their mobile and digital user experiences on real devices under real end-user conditions.

3. Responsive screen testing – Screenfly

You probably use responsive web design, we all know it’s helpful yet can be tricky at times. Layouts look different on different screens and issues you never thought of arise. Screenfly is a user-friendly tool that enables you to view your mobile website in different screen sizes and resolutions. Screenfly will test your responsive design to help you optimize your website.

4. Mobile monetization page yield engine – Browsi

We all want to to good, but we also look to monetize on our efforts. Browsi, an automatic mobile monetization engine allows publishers to discover untapped revenue opportunities in their mobile web pages. Browsi’s engine, scans multiple page elements (length, number of paragraphs, images and videos) in real-time, as every page loads, to detect new potential ad placements which can lead to new revenue without compromising user experience or disrupting the current monetization operation.

7. Social media management tool – Hootsuite

Using social media channels is a very effective way to get more traffic to your mobile website. Having presence on social media channels is a necessity and frankly is kind of expected these days.

One of the most popular tools for social media management is Hootsuite. It offers a free, pro and enterprise solution for managing unlimited social profiles, enhanced analytics, advanced message scheduling a well as Google Analytics and Facebook insights integration.
